基于Web的高校学生学籍管理系统设计与实现
本文主要介绍了基于Web的高校学生学籍管理系统的设计与实现。该系统采用B/S架构,使用开源数据库MySQL作为后台数据库,服务端脚本采用PHP语言编写。系统的设计主要考虑了高校学生学籍管理的需求,旨在实现通过网络实时管理学生的学籍工作,使学生、学生所在院系、教务部门与学生管理部门之间建立紧密的联系。
系统的构成:
基于B/S架构的高校学生学籍管理系统主要由三个部分组成:前台、应用服务器和数据库服务器。前台部分使用HTML、CSS和JavaScript等技术,负责用户界面和用户交互;应用服务器部分使用PHP语言编写,负责业务逻辑处理和数据处理;数据库服务器部分使用MySQL数据库,负责数据存储和管理。
系统的功能:
本系统主要提供了以下几个功能:
* 学生学籍信息管理:系统可以对学生的学籍信息进行添加、删除、修改和查询等操作。
* 学生个人信息管理:系统可以对学生的个人信息进行添加、删除、修改和查询等操作。
* 学生奖励和惩罚信息管理:系统可以对学生的奖励和惩罚信息进行添加、删除、修改和查询等操作。
* 学生报到和注册信息管理:系统可以对学生的报到和注册信息进行添加、删除、修改和查询等操作。
* 学生档案信息管理:系统可以对学生的档案信息进行添加、删除、修改和查询等操作。
系统的设计理念:
本系统的设计理念主要基于以下几点:
* WEB化:系统基于Web架构,使用浏览器/服务器模式,用户可以通过网络访问系统。
* 开源化:系统使用开源数据库MySQL和开源脚本语言PHP,降低了系统的开发和维护成本。
* 高度灵活性:系统的设计考虑了高校学生学籍管理的需求,可以满足不同高校的需求。
* 高度可扩展性:系统的设计考虑了高校学生学籍管理的需求,可以满足不同高校的需求。
系统的实现:
本系统的实现主要包括以下几个方面:
* 数据库设计:使用MySQL数据库,设计了学生学籍信息表、学生个人信息表、学生奖励和惩罚信息表、学生报到和注册信息表、学生档案信息表等多个表。
* 服务端脚本编写:使用PHP语言编写了服务端脚本,实现了学生学籍信息的添加、删除、修改和查询等操作。
* 客户端编写:使用HTML、CSS和JavaScript等技术,实现了用户界面和用户交互。
结论:
本文主要介绍了基于Web的高校学生学籍管理系统的设计与实现。该系统可以满足高校学生学籍管理的需求,提高了高校学生学籍管理的效率和水平。